Summary: | The Higher Education Center for Urban Studies (HECUS) was formed as a consortium in 1968 by 5 institutions of higher education located in or near Bridgeport, Connecticut. It has been involved mainly in urban research, community service, and in facilitating educational services for disadvantaged people. This report is a study made to determine whether or not HECUS should continue the present course and nature of its operations, or should redirect them. During the period of the study, 4 additional institutions became members of HECUS. Their representatives, along with those of the original members, as well as selected program participants and representatives of certain community agencies, comprised the study committee. The study committee found that HECUS is making progress along worthwhile paths of action. The committee's recommendations pertain mainly to an expansion of the scope of HECUS' operations and to an acceleration of the pace of HECUS' development. (Author/HS) |
